首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将装载器几何图形从三个js导出到JSON

是指将装载器(Loader)的几何图形数据从JavaScript文件导出为JSON格式的数据。

装载器是一种用于加载和解析各种资源文件的工具,常用于前端开发中。它可以加载并解析包括几何图形、纹理、模型等在内的各种资源文件,并将其转化为可供程序使用的数据格式。

在这个问答中,将装载器几何图形从三个js导出到JSON的过程可以分为以下几个步骤:

  1. 加载器几何图形的导入:首先,需要使用相应的加载器(如Three.js中的JSONLoader)加载三个js文件,这些文件包含了装载器几何图形的数据。
  2. 解析几何图形数据:加载器会解析这些js文件中的数据,并将其转化为可供程序使用的几何图形数据。
  3. 导出为JSON格式:将解析后的几何图形数据转化为JSON格式的数据。JSON是一种轻量级的数据交换格式,易于阅读和编写,并且可以被多种编程语言解析和使用。
  4. 存储JSON数据:将导出的JSON数据存储到文件或数据库中,以便后续的读取和使用。

装载器几何图形从三个js导出到JSON的优势是:

  • 数据格式标准化:将几何图形数据导出为JSON格式可以使数据的结构更加清晰和标准化,方便后续的处理和使用。
  • 跨平台兼容性:JSON是一种通用的数据格式,可以被多种编程语言和平台解析和使用,提高了数据的可移植性和兼容性。
  • 数据传输效率:相比于其他数据格式,如XML,JSON具有更小的数据体积,可以减少数据传输的带宽和时间成本。

将装载器几何图形从三个js导出到JSON的应用场景包括但不限于:

  • 3D模型加载:在游戏开发、虚拟现实(VR)和增强现实(AR)等领域中,将3D模型的几何图形数据导出为JSON格式可以方便地进行加载和渲染。
  • 数据交换和共享:将几何图形数据导出为JSON格式可以方便地进行数据交换和共享,例如在不同的项目或平台之间共享和使用几何图形数据。
  • 数据存储和管理:将几何图形数据导出为JSON格式可以方便地进行存储和管理,例如将数据存储到数据库中,并进行索引和查询。

腾讯云相关产品中,与几何图形数据处理和存储相关的产品包括:

  • 腾讯云对象存储(COS):用于存储和管理各种类型的文件和数据,可以将导出的JSON数据存储到COS中。产品介绍链接:https://cloud.tencent.com/product/cos
  • 腾讯云数据库(TencentDB):提供多种类型的数据库服务,可以用于存储和管理几何图形数据。产品介绍链接:https://cloud.tencent.com/product/cdb
  • 腾讯云云函数(SCF):用于编写和运行无服务器的代码逻辑,可以用于处理和转换几何图形数据。产品介绍链接:https://cloud.tencent.com/product/scf

请注意,以上只是腾讯云提供的一些相关产品,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【自然框架】n级下拉列表框的原理

首先要设置记录集,这里用DataSet来装载,二级联动,里面就要有两个DataTable;三级联动,里面就要有三个DataTable。同理,n级联动就要有n个DataTable。   ...的数组,当初不会json,也不喜欢xml,所以就用数组来装载了。...把这个数组输出到页面里。然后客户端的js就可以访问到需要的数据了。   下面说一下客户端。客户端是通过js的onchange函数实现联动,原理呢就是“递归”。...注意点:   1、由于用的是服务控件DropDownList,他有一个“特点”,那就是在客户端用js设置的item,在服务端都是不承认的。...然后打算引入jQuery和json来简化一下代码,再然后看看能不能做成纯客户端的,就是不用服务控件了,直接使用 html的input。

3.6K70

高性能笔迹原理

,如触摸框 和 屏幕 和 PC 主机 触摸框收到触摸消息, PC 进行处理告诉屏幕如何绘制,在屏幕进行绘制 简单分为三个硬件,此时假定触摸框收到触摸点到点传到 PC 用的时间是 30 毫秒。...在 PC 收到触摸消息到应用程序处理完成等通过 HDMI 输出到显卡需要的时间是 15 毫秒。...在显示屏幕收到 HDMI 输出到屏幕刷新需要的时间是 16 毫秒 那么此时极限优化的笔迹延时就是三个硬件中速度最慢的触摸框硬件,也就是 30 毫秒以上 这就是高性能笔迹的核心了 在 Windows 下...本质上笔迹的渲染就是 几何图形 的渲染,笔迹就是使用 Geometry 几何图形的渲染,对比基础图形和图片的渲染,在 2D 下渲染几何图形是最吃显卡的 因此有显卡和没有显卡使用 CPU 计算的性能差很大...但不要再开一个渲染线程,因为渲染多线程不好玩 这里说的渲染线程指的是从上层 UI 线程拿到了绘制数据,在渲染线程绘制数据转绘制命令发送到 DX 进行渲染。

85821
  • 渲染流程之应用阶段及几何处理阶段

    native的Surface),Native的Surface接收到后转换成Bitmap存储在DisplayList中,稍后会通知RenderThread去做渲染处理 RenderThread接受到之后会DisplayLis...(后面分析离屏渲染的解决) GPU: 几何处理阶段:处理图元 主要工作:计算纹理,光照(后续片段着色上色用),图元转换成Virtex并连接,添加额外的Virtex生成更复杂的几何图形 上次Surface...转换成Bitmpa后这个对应的好像就是图元,然后GPU区在对图元进行处理生成新的图元,主要由这些处理处理: 顶点着色:图元中的顶点信息进行视角转换,添加光照信息,增加纹理等操作。...形状装配:图元中的三角形,线段,点对应三个Vertex,两个Vertex,一个Vertex。这个阶段会将Vertex连接成对应的形状。...几何着色:添加额外的Vertex,原始图元转换成新图元,以构建一个不一样的模型,简单说就是通过三角形,线段和点来构建更复杂的几何图形 参考链接:https://segmentfault.com/a/

    51120

    Google Earth Engine(GEE)——GEE最全介绍(7000字长文)初学者福音!

    控制台选项卡 当您print()脚本中获取某些内容时,例如文本、对象或图表,结果显示在Console 中。控制台是交互式的,因此您可以展开打印对象以获取有关它们的更多详细信息。...几何工具 您还可以通过在屏幕上绘制几何图形几何图形导入脚本。要创建几何图形,请使用地图显示左上角的几何图形绘制工具(图 8)。...要将几何图形添加到新图层,请将鼠标悬停在地图显示中的几何图形导入上,然后单击+new layer链接。您还可以几何导入部分切换几何的可见性。...要配置几何图形导入脚本的方式,请单击 地图上Geometry Imports部分或代码编辑的Imports部分中图层旁边的图标。几何图层设置工具显示在一个对话框中,该对话框应类似于图 9。...单击 help 单击代码编辑右上角的按钮,可以查看指向本开发人员指南、其他帮助论坛、代码编辑览以及有助于在地图上进行编码、运行代码和显示数据的键盘快捷键列表的链接。

    1.7K11

    【工具包】让编程之路如虎添翼的编程小工具集合!

    1 Notepad++ Notepad++ 程序员必备的文本编辑,软件小巧高效,支持27种编程语言,通吃C,C++ ,Java ,C#, XML, HTML, PHP,JS 等,推荐各位下载使用。...5 HiJson 使用HiJson工具并通过此工具快速查看JSON字符串、熟悉JSON的数据结构。...针对程序员来说,如果了解了连续字符串对应的JSON的数据组成,便可以快速对JSON字符串进行数据处理。...6 XMind Xmind是一款全球领先的思维图软件,除了可以轻松绘制基本逻辑图之外,还支持组织如结构图(竖直)、树状图(水平+竖直)、思维图(辐射)、鱼骨图、二维图(表格)模型。...Xmind Pro可以将我们的图形显示给他人,或者图形内容导出到MicrosoftPowerpoint、Word中,令复杂的思想和信息得到更快的交流。

    1.4K60

    【入门教程】Rollup模块打包整合

    ES 模块语法: 思维图地址:es模块语法 快速开始: 常见编译输出风格: 命名 风格 适用 iife 立即执行函数 浏览 cjs CommonJs NodeJs umd 通用模块定义 浏览/NodeJs...典型配置文件: 下面是一个典型的使用ES6模块默认导出风格的配置,main.js文件编译为CommonJs模块风格,输出到bundle.js中。...; 只编译,不输出到文件: 执行命令:rollup src/main.js -f cjs // 输出内容 'use strict'; var foo = 'hello world!'.../plugin-json插件: // rollup.config.js import json from '@rollup/plugin-json'; export default { ......plugins: [json()] }; 再次编译并在node中使用: 编译后的产物只包含使用到得version,体现了Tree-Shaking的作用。

    1.2K20

    MyEMS的安装部署与数据读取查看

    如有必要,检查并更改配置文件: cd myems/myems-web notepad src/config.js 警告 nginx.conf中的127.00.1:8000替换为真正的HOST IP和myems-api...如果您想将镜像迁移到另一台计算机, 镜像导出到tar文件 docker save --output myems-api.tar myems/myems-api tar文件复制到另一台计算机,然后tar...tar文件复制到另一台计算机,然后tar文件加载镜像 docker load --input ....如有必要,检查并更改配置文件: cd myems/myems-web nano src/config.js 警告 nginx.conf中的127.00.1:8000替换为真正的HOST IP和myems-api...格式的寄存起地址并填写对应属性,属性分别为站地址(slave_id),功能码(function_code),起始地址(offset),寄存数量(number_of_registers),数据格式(format

    66310

    万字梳理 Webpack 常用配置和优化方案

    loader loader 相当于是一个转换。webpack 默认只能解析 js / json 文件,对于其他类型的文件需要借助 loader 进行转换,之后才能解析。...这三个 hash 通常和 CDN 缓存有关,代码改变触发文件 hash 改变,hash 改变导致资源引用的 URL 改变,从而触发 CDN 回源服务器重新拉取最新的资源。...一般是两个角度考量: 更好地利用缓存:假如 css 没有 js 文件中分离出来,那么每次 js 或者 css 改变,用户都得重新下载整个文件;而分离之后,两者独立,一方改变后,另一方的缓存仍可利用,...对于 page1.js:本身 entry 文件就会对应一个 chunk,而 jq 和 react 都是同步导入的,因此不会从这个 chunk 中分离,它们三个最终会打包到一起,并输出到 page1.bundle.js...module.exports = { resolve: { // 默认可以省略 .js 和 .json 后缀名 extensions: ['.js','.json

    2.7K52

    【实战】用 WebGL 创建一个在线画廊

    通常我们需要:一台照相机,一个场景和一个渲染,它将把所有内容输出到一个 canvas 元素中。然后在 requestAnimationFrame 循环中用相机在渲染中渲染场景。...为了表示所有图像,我们将使用平面几何图形,所以要创建一个新方法并将新几何图形存储在 this.planeGeometry 变量中。...在构造函数中存储所需的所有变量,这些变量是 index.js 的 new Media() 初始化时传递的: export default class { constructor ({ geometry.../vertex.glsl' 之后在 createMesh 方法中创建 new Mesh() 实例,几何图形和着色合并在一起。...第一步是滚动的方向包含在来自 index.js 的 update方法中: update () { this.scroll.current = lerp(this.scroll.current, this.scroll.target

    3K20

    微信小程序的渗透五脉(访道篇)

    No.2 小程序包浅析 在开发者⾃⼰的⼩程序上传之后,微信服务会将⼩程序打包为以 wxapkg 作为扩展名的⼩程序数据 包供客户端下载及使⽤。...⼩程序包共由:头部段、索引段、数据段三个部分组成,在iOS和安卓客户端 中并没有对⼩程序包进⾏加密保存。下⾯就让我们在Hex编辑中打开数据包,来分别了解⼀下这个三个数据包段。...原来,在微信服务会将⼩程序源码中所有的“js”⽂件压⼊“app-service.js”⽂件中,所有的“json”⽂件 压⼊“app-config.json”中,所有的“wxml”⽂件压⼊“page-frame.html...JSON数据还原: 我们在编辑中打开“app-config.json”⽂件,“page”段中每个“window”段内的json⽂ 件便为原本对应⻚⾯下的json⽂件,剩下部分(下图红框处)则为“app.json...微信原本的wxml⻚⾯直接处理成js格式放⼊“page-frame.html”⽂件中,并进⾏ 了⼀些代码混淆。

    2.1K20

    详解航空燃油滑油3D打印热交换设计流程

    设计过程涵盖三个步骤:原始的CAD设计,nTOP 平台中的设计,通过ANSYS CFX 进行流体力学仿真分析(CFD)。...▲图2 管壳式热交换 来源:nTopology l 在有限空间中提高热性能 设计师需要在给定的有限空间中进行设计优化,一种有效的办法是使用高级几何图形,以数学方式精确地控制此设计空间内部的几何图形。...l 设计方法 接下来,我们来了解一下增材制造FCOC热交换的具体设计方法。 图4概述了几何图形nTop 平台转换为所选CFD工具的过程。...该过程是由用户隔离热交换的流体域,并在nTop 平台中生成这些流体域的体积网格来定义的, 然后这些流体体积网格导入CFD工具,应用适当的边界条件,再进行流体模拟。...nTop 平台能够创建复杂的几何图形(TPMS结构、流体体积、平滑的格-固过渡),同时保持对几何模型的完全控制,然后几何图形出到外部的仿真平台进行验证。

    1K20

    大数据同步工具DataX与Sqoop之比较

    Sqoop是一个用来Hadoop和关系型数据库中的数据相互转移的工具,可以一个关系型数据库(例如 : MySQL ,Oracle ,Postgres等)中的数据进到Hadoop的HDFS中,也可以...HDFS的数据进到关系型数据库中。...Sub-job: 数据同步作业切分后的小任务 Reader(Loader): 数据读入模块,负责运行切分后的小任务,数据源头装载入DataX Storage: Reader和Writer通过Storage...交换数据 Writer(Dumper): 数据写出模块,负责数据DataX导入至目的数据地 Sqoop架构图 ?...大数据同步工具DataX与Sqoop之比较 在我的测试环境上,一台只有700m内存的,IO低下的oracle数据库,百兆的网络,使用Quest的Sqoop插件在4个并行度的情况下,导出到HDFS速度有

    7.7K100

    云函数 + TypeScript + Node.js 最佳实践探索

    如果不使用 typescript,仅使用 js 编写 nodejs 程序,则不需要编译的过程,部署函数时,只需要打包然后部署即可;但是使用 typescript 后,则多了一步 ts 代码编译成 js...→ tsconfig.json 指定编译 src 文件夹下的 ts 文件,输出到 dist 文件夹 ? → template.yaml CodeUri 指向 dist 文件夹 ?...修改的地方如下: index.ts 文件 src 文件夹移动到根目录 → tsconfig.json 编辑根目录下的 index.ts 和 src 文件夹下的 ts 文件,剔除 node_modules...第三个 是在根目录写一个 index.js 文件,调用具有真正逻辑的入口函数,做个转发,如第五次尝试,也就是本人认为目前最好的实践方式。...这场沙龙围绕腾讯云 Serverless 2.0 的运行原理、应用场景,腾讯云云函数的架构设计、冷启动优化、本地开发调试,以及 Serverless 在乐凯撒新餐饮服务上的应用实践, 0 到 1 介绍

    2.9K62

    gd.so和php_gd2.so 有什么区别

    可以官方网站www.boutell.com/gd处下载,目前GD库支持gif,png,jpeg,wbmp,xbm等多种图像格式。GD库通常用于对图像的处理。  ...通过GD库中的函数可以完成各种点、线、几何图形、文本以及颜色的操作和处理,也可以创建或读取多种格式的图像文件。...在PHP中,通过GD库处理图像的操作,都是先在内存中处理,操作完成以后再以文件流的方式,输出到浏览或保存在服务的磁盘中。创建一个图像应该完成如下所示的四个基本步骤。...(3)输出图像:完成整个图像的绘制以后,需要将图像以某种格式保存到服务指定的文件中,或图像直接输出到浏览上显示给用户。...但在图像输出之前,一定要使用header()函数发送Content-type通知浏览,这次发送的是图片不是文本。 (4)释放资源:图像被输出以后,画布中的内容也不再有用。

    4.5K30

    AJAX应用【股票案例、验证码校验】

    我们首先来看一下要做出来的效果: 服务端分析 首先,效果图我们可以看见很多股票基本信息:昨天收盘价、今天开盘价、最高价、最低价、当前价格、涨幅。这些信息我们用一个类来描述出来。...服务端的数据和客户端交互,我们使用JSON吧 服务端代码 Stock股票类的代码 股票基本信息: private String id; private String name;...var stock = json[id]; //当前的价格设置到span节点里面 document.getElementById...⑤:当然啦,装载股票的任务就交给init()方法,因为只需要装载一次。...⑩:浏览想要不断地服务端获取股票的数据,那么就需要不断地与服务端交互,解析JSON,填充数据.....这种我们可以通过setInterval()定时来做 ①①:想要修改字体的颜色,只要获取它的控件再

    2K100

    微信小程序初步入坑指南

    (配置文件),wxml(页面文件,类似于html),js文件(处理页面的相关交互,和网页类似) js中有一个page,为一个页面的构造,渲染页面的时候先装载json文件,配置当前的顶部导航,接着装载wxml...文件,配置页面的DOM,在装载wxss,进行对页面样式的处理 和网页的类似,都是同样的 最后将会读取js文件,根据页面中的page函数即构造中的内容,wxml和data进行绑定,渲染出结果,为mvvm...mvc 分别是模型层,视图层,和控制,当用户请求到达以后,将会先经过路由,即入口文件,即主文件中的server.js文件,接着进入lib目录下的route.js文件,对路由进行分发,路由在数据传递给控制...视图层接受事件的反馈,开发者写的所有文件都会打包成为一份js文件,小程序运行时启动,小程序离开时销毁, 吐槽 一些浏览里的js在微信小程序无法使用,小程序还有npm?...}, 当用户切换tab的时候,将会立马输出当前页面的path值 其中this指代当前的page,因为是在一个page函数内部 Page.prototype.setData 为page的继承函数,数据逻辑层发送到视图层

    1.2K40

    初探富文本之OT协同实例

    在富文本领域,最经典的Operation有quill的delta模型,通过retain、insert、delete三个操作完成整篇文档的描述与操作,还有slate的JSON模型,通过insert_text...├── package.json ├── rollup.config.js ├── rollup.server.js └── tsconfig.json 先简略说明下各个文件夹和文件的作用,public...这个JSON OT类型可用于编辑任意JSON文档,实际上不光是JSON文档,我们的计数也就是使用json0来实现的,毕竟在这里计数也是只需要通过借助JSON的一个字段就可以实现的。...其实看是否可以支持某些操作,直接看其文档中是不是有定义的操作就可以了,比如本例子中需要实现的计数,就需要{p:[path], na:x}这个Op,x添加到[path]处的数字,具体的文档可以参考https...quill的数据结构并不是JSON而是Delta,Delta是通过retain、insert、delete三个操作完成整篇文档的描述与操作,那么这样我们就不能使用json0来对数据结构进行描述了,我们需要使用新的

    70120
    领券